Opportunity – the ‘what’

In this role, you’ll be responsible for:

  • Processing and delivering digital assets (text, images, audio, video, animations, games) to internal teams and suppliers.
  • Uploading content to test and live platforms, ensuring accuracy and stability.
  • Integrating content into interactive templates and supporting quality assurance checks.
  • Providing administrative and technical support to ensure timely and budget-compliant delivery of ELT digital products.
  • Collaborating with team members to identify and implement process improvements and automation opportunities.

Your work will directly impact the efficiency and quality of our digital product delivery, contributing to the success of the ELT Division and enhancing the learning experience for users globally.

About You

Essential Criteria

  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el), HTML, XML, Adobe Creative Suite, and InDesign.
  • Experience processing digital files in a publishing or media environment.
  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ills.
  • High standard of literacy and numeracy; university graduate or equivalent experience.
  • Proven English language proficiency at CEFR level C1.
  • Qualification or relevant experience in a digital or media environment.
  • Proven experience working effectively in team environments to achieve project goals.

Desirable Criteria

  • Coding experience in Python.
  • CEFR level C2 English proficiency.
  • Experience in publishing or publishing services environments.
